Forum |  HardWare.fr | News | Articles | PC | S'identifier | S'inscrire | Shop Recherche
1640 connectés 

  FORUM HardWare.fr
  Programmation
  SQL/NoSQL

  Mysql : copier un champ vers un autre sauf s'il existe déjà

 


 Mot :   Pseudo :  
 
Bas de page
Auteur Sujet :

Mysql : copier un champ vers un autre sauf s'il existe déjà

n°1964708
georgesmou​ton
Posté le 10-02-2010 à 18:36:39  profilanswer
 

Bonjour à tous, je sèche sur un problème de copier coller en mysql...
 
Dans une table, j'ai des données dans un champ A et d'autres dans un champ B. Chaque enregistrement n'a qu'un seul des deux champs remplis. Pour simplifier la structure de la table, je souhaiterais réunir ces deux champs en un seul. Pour cela, je veux copier les données de A vers le champ B. Mais j'imagine qu'un vulgaire copier coller écraserait les données de B. Existe-til une formule pour dire qqchse comme ça :
 
Copier Donnée du Champ A vers Champ B sauf si donnée B existe
 
En gros, une sorte d'addition comme dans excel.
 
Qqn aurait-il une idée ? Merci bcp d'avance :: )))

mood
Publicité
Posté le 10-02-2010 à 18:36:39  profilanswer
 

n°1964984
vttman2
Je suis Open ...
Posté le 11-02-2010 à 13:30:37  profilanswer
 

Un truc comme ça quoi ...
 
update matable
set champb = champa
where champb is null
 


---------------
il n'y a pas que le VTT dans la vie, il y a le Snowboard aussi ...
n°1964998
georgesmou​ton
Posté le 11-02-2010 à 14:07:17  profilanswer
 

Salut, merci, oui c'est exactement ça, je suis parti dans des trucs d'addition hier alors que c'est finalement tt bête


Aller à :
Ajouter une réponse
  FORUM HardWare.fr
  Programmation
  SQL/NoSQL

  Mysql : copier un champ vers un autre sauf s'il existe déjà

 

Sujets relatifs
Existe-t-il un logiciel pour analyser une source ?[PHP/MYSQL] Definir un debut de journée.
Focus sur un champRequete mysql qui s'execute avant l'execution de la page
Requete MySQL avec condition globalecopier données de IE vers excel
Rendre un diapo cliquable vers un lienAccess vers excel
Plus de sujets relatifs à : Mysql : copier un champ vers un autre sauf s'il existe déjà


Copyright © 1997-2022 Hardware.fr SARL (Signaler un contenu illicite / Données personnelles) / Groupe LDLC / Shop HFR